Flat roof replacement in Manchester, CT, involves removing an existing flat roof and installing a new surface to ensure durability and weather resistance. The scope of the project can vary based on the size of the roof, materials chosen, and complexity of the installation. Understanding typical considerations can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ly.
- Materials: Common options include EPDM rubber, TPO, PVC, and built-up roofing, each offering different durability and cost profiles.
- Size and Scope: Roof sizes in Manchester homes can range from small extensions to larger commercial flat roofs, influencing overall project scope.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as roof access, existing roof condition, and structural features can affect installation difficulty and duration.
- Permitting: Local building permits are typically required for roof replacement projects, with regulations varying by project size and scope.
- Additional Considerations: Options such as insulation upgrades, drainage systems, and flashing repairs may be included or added to the project scope.
